Pre Requirements Required technical and professional expertise Government of Canada Security Clearance is a requirement for this role. You must be eligible to obtain Secret, NATO and Controlled Goods Clearances

  • Must be either a Canadian Citizen or Canadian Permanent Resident
  • Must have resided in Canada for a minimum of 10 consecutive years, without leaving Canada (for any reason) for more than 30 days at a time OR traveling abroad to any non-NATO countries for any period
  • Must have a clean criminal and credit history

This role involves examination, possession or transfer of controlled goods and technology as defined under the Canadian Controlled Goods Program and ITAR data/technology. To be eligible for employment in this role, you must be a Canadian citizen or Canadian Permanent Resident.  Canadian citizens and permanent residents must be security assessed under the Canadian controlled goods program. If you hold dual or third nationality, in addition to being either a Canadian citizen or Canadian Permanent Resident the nationality must be from one of the following countries in order to be eligible for employment in this role: Australia, Austria, Belgium, Bulgaria, Canada, Czech Republic, Denmark, Finland, France, Germany, Greece, Hungary, Italy, Japan, Latvia, Lithuania, Luxembourg, Netherlands, New Zealand, Norway,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Slovenia, Spain, Sweden, Switzerland, Turkey, the United Kingdom, United States of America. All applicants will also be required to undergo an additional security assessment conducted by an IBM designated Controlled Goods Program official as a condition of employment.

This role is onsite in Ottawa, Ontario only.
